Woman accused of bringing loaded gun into church restroom appears in court
WAUKESHA COUNTY (WITI) -- 67-year-old Susan Hitchler appeared in a Waukesha County courtroom on Monday, December 8th for her initial appearance on a charge of disorderly conduct.Hitchler is accused of bringing a loaded gun into a restroom at Elmbrook Church in Brookfield last March.An initial charge of endangering safety by use of a dangerous weapon was dropped against Hitchler this past June — but a criminal complaint filed on November 24th charges her with disorderly conduct.The Brookfield Police Department was called in to investigate after a loaded gun was found in the Elmbrook Church’s bathroom in March 2014 — while a children’s program was in progress.A church worker discovered the gun in a stall in the women’s restroom on the main floor of Elmbrook Church.A criminal complaint says a female employee came out of the bathroom after finding the gun, and carried it to a volunteer worker at the front desk.
New Berlin police want to speak with man following "suspicious incident" involving young girl
NEW BERLIN (WITI) -- New Berlin police say they're looking to talk with a man following a "suspicious incident" that occurred on Tuesday, December 2nd shortly after 8:00 a.m.Police say they took a report of an attempted child abduction in the area of Salentine Drive and Calhoun Road in the city of New Berlin.During an investigation, police learned a suspicious man driving a silver and blue Honda Accord (last seen traveling eastbound on Salentine Drive from Calhoun Road) waved and slowed down, coming to a stop as he approached a six-year-old girl who was waiting for the school bus at the end of her driveway.Police say the girl initially told her mother the man asked her to "come here," but later told police the man didn't speak to her at all.The man drove away as the girl's mother exited the home, and as the school bus was approaching.Police say the man never opened his car door or exited his car.He's described as a white man in his late 20s or early 30s with dark hair.

Waukesha will likely miss court-ordered 2018 deadline to secure new water source
WAUKESHA (WITI) -- Waukesha is likely to miss its court-ordered 2018 deadline to secure a new source of drinking water.The city will likely ask a court to extend the deadline.Waukesha's current system of wells doesn't meet federal radium standards on days of heavy use.Waukesha officials plan to purchase water from Oak Creek, but that plan remains under review by the Wisconsin Department of Natural Resources.If that is approved, the plan must be endorsed by a council of governors of states bordering the Great Lakes.CLICK HERE for more on this story via the Milwaukee Business Journal.

RESCUED: Crews free man trapped in hole 30 feet underground in Waukesha County
WAUKESHA COUNTY (WITI) -- Fire crews from Waukesha, Pewaukee and Lisbon were called to rescue a man from a hole 30 feet underground.It happened at Weyer and Duplainville Road in Waukesha County.Authorities say while working to clear a hole underneath the road, a man became stuck in equipment.It took crews 30 minutes to free him.Crews dropped a basket to bring him out from the hole.
